This Act provides for a decentralised national system of planning and development. The Act defines planning duties of various local authorities established under the Local Government Act, 1993 and specifies procedures for the preparation and adoption of local development plans. The system shall be coordinated by the National Development Planning Commission, established under the National Development Planning Commission Act, 1994.
This Decree provides for the protection of public land from unlawful deeds, occupation, trespass or other illegal encroachment or interference.The Decree prescribes penalties for unlawful sale or occupation of public land and provides for the ejection of trespassers. The Decree further defines “public land” and defines responsibility for offences committed by legal juristic persons.
This Decree provides rules for the stipulation and execution of a mortgage and defines the effects of a mortgage and relative rights and duties of mortgagors and mortgagees.The rules of this Decree shall govern all mortgages. A mortgage may be created in any interest in movable property which is alienable. The Schedules to this Decree specify implied covenants and model precedents for the form of a mortgage.
This Act provides rules relative to the survey of soil and land and the demarcation of land with boundary marks. It also provides for the protection of boundary marks and defines the powers of the Director of Geological Survey, officers of the Geological Survey Department and other persons authorized to carry out land or soil survey.Only authorized persons (e.g. official and licensed surveyors) may carry out surveys of land for the purpose of preparing any plan for attachment to any instrument or conveyance, leases, assignments, charge or transfer.
